Green Pond Reservoir – Rockaway NJ

Description

“One of the big projects accomplished during the CWA program in Morris County and now nearly completed is the creation of a storage reservoir on top of Green Pond Mountain and within the Picatinny arsenal limits. This will cut out considerable pumping costs and prove a real economy in the future. Atop of Green Pond Mountain…lies a swamp….This natural basin of several acres in extent collects many thousand gallons of water from the nearby slopes….The basin is surrounded by many drainage slopes leading thereto which act as natural feeders to it. Consideration has frequently been given to a contemplated dam construction…With the availability of Civil Works Administration funds this admirable project became a reality. Thousands of man hours of labor were provided and filled by persons from the emergency relief lists at Dover, Morristown and other nearby centers….construction work being accomplished by skilled, semiskilled and unskilled labor…1071 days of man labor, 53 truck days, 20 portable shovel days, etc.” (May 21, 1934)
